FMCSA L&I filing evidence — not a shipper certificate of insurance (COI). Cargo (BMC-34) is primarily an HHG / household-goods requirement; general freight carriers often have none.
No active broker surety bond or trust fund on file.
BMC-84 is a surety bond; BMC-85 is a trust-fund agreement. Required for property brokers / freight forwarders — not motor-carrier BIPD liability insurance.

Authority Records (above) are FMCSA docket status and lifecycle events. MC Certificate Documents here are the archived PDF letters for each action — grants, reinstatements, revocations, name changes, and transfers. They are related but not the same dataset: one row per PDF letter, not one file per docket.
Each row is a distinct FMCSA letter (grant, reinstatement, revocation, name change, transfer, etc.). When a PDF is archived, click the link to open that letter. Rows without a link still show the action type and date from our index. FMCSA stopped publishing new daily certificate PDFs after the May 2026 Motus cutover — rows below are historical archive only.
